At an altitude of 850m, this chasm measures around 60m by 30m and is accessible via a viewing platform for a safe visit. It is an abyss of both absorption and collapse. The total depth is around 110m.
This hole used to be a horse charnel house. When horses came to the end of their lives, their owners would take them to this chasm. So it's easy to see why this hole was so popular with crows...
